Lets compare vitamin content per 1 kilogram of Boiled Cauliflower with Salt vs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Cauliflower with Salt has 1.9 times more Vitamin B5 and 1.3 times more Vitamin B6 than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li contains 51 times more Vitamin A, 1.3 times more Vitamin B1, 1.6 times more Vitamin B2, 1.3 times more Vitamin B9, 18.9 times more Vitamin E and 6.4 times more Vitamin K than Boiled and Drained Cauliflower with Salt.
- Both Boiled Cauliflower with Salt and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li provide similar amounts of Vitamin B3 and Vitamin C per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Cauliflower with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A and Vitamin E
- Both Boiled and Drained Cauliflower with Salt as well as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in one kilogram.
Comparing minerals per 1 kilogram for Boiled Cauliflower with Salt vs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Cauliflower with Salt has 22 times more Sodium than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li contains 2.1 times more Calcium, 1.9 times more Copper, 1.9 times more Iron, 1.4 times more Magnesium, 1.7 times more Manganese, 1.5 times more Phosphorus and 1.6 times more Zinc than Boiled and Drained Cauliflower with Salt.
- Both Boiled Cauliflower with Salt and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li contain similar levels of Potassium and Water per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Cauliflower with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Calcium, Copper and Zinc
- Both Boiled and Drained Cauliflower with Salt as well as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li lack sufficient amounts of Selenium in one kilogram.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 kilogram:
- 1 kilogram of Boiled Cauliflower with Salt has 4 times more Omega 3 and 1.3 times more Sugars than Cooked Chopped Frozen Broccoli.
- While 1 kg of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li contains 1.3 times more Carbohydrate, 1.3 times more Fiber and 1.7 times more Protein than Boiled and Drained Cauliflower with Salt.
- Both Boiled and Drained Cauliflower with Salt as well as Boiled Chopped Frozen Broccoli provide inadequate amounts of Energy and Omega 6 in one kilogram.
